Transaction 3743468e57f33489b332ee8206d752b3b4984c3f623a5070783bf508ce65d2af
1 Input
1 Output
-
3743468e57f33489b332ee8206d752b3b4984c3f623a5070783bf508ce65d2af:0
- value
- 4031926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9861a0d7316de1d838450f9aeebc40e245155da7 OP_EQUAL
- address
- 3Fajb2vmTF4YsmDH57UGSHjrNEwrBuWFbm